package gov.nasa.jpf.util;

/**
 * an object that holds a mutable int. Unfortunately, java.lang.Integer is
 * final, but we can at least be a Number
 */
public class MutableInteger extends Number {

  private int value;
  
  public MutableInteger (int val){
    value = val;
  }
  
  public void set (int val){
    value = val;
  }
  
  //--- arithmetic operations
  public MutableInteger inc() {
    value++;
    return this;
  }
  
  public MutableInteger dec() {
    value--;
    return this;
  }
  
  public MutableInteger add (int n){
    value += n;
    return this;
  }
  
  public MutableInteger subtract (int n){
    value -= n;
    return this;
  }
  
  public MutableInteger multiply (int n){
    value *= n;
    return this;
  }
  
  public MutableInteger divide (int n){
    value /= n;
    return this;
  }
  
  //-- Hmm, we probably want to round correctly for these
  public MutableInteger add (Number n){
    value += n.intValue();
    return this;
  }
  
  public MutableInteger subtract (Number n){
    value -= n.intValue();
    return this;
  }
  
  public MutableInteger multiply (Number n){
    value *= n.intValue();
    return this;
  }
  
  public MutableInteger divide (Number n){
    value /= n.intValue();
    return this;
  }
  
  //--- value accessors
  
  @Override
  public double doubleValue() {
    return value;
  }

  @Override
  public float floatValue() {
    return value;
  }

  @Override
  public int intValue() {
    return value;
  }

  @Override
  public long longValue() {
    return value;
  }
}
